Photovoltaic Panel Modern Technology Basics



To absolutely realize the essence of photovoltaic panel technology, you need to explore the fundamental principles that underpin its capability. Solar panels consist of solar batteries, normally made from silicon, which have the exceptional capability to transform sunshine right into electrical energy with the photovoltaic impact. When sunlight strikes the cells, the photons in the light interact with the silicon atoms, triggering the electrons to break without their atomic bonds. This creates an electric current that can then be utilized for powering numerous gadgets.



The essential part of photovoltaic panels is the semiconductors within the solar batteries, which facilitate the conversion of sunshine into usable power. These semiconductors have both positive and negative layers, producing an electric area that enables the flow of electrons.

This circulation of electrons, when linked in a circuit, creates straight present (DC) electricity. Understanding these basic concepts is important for appreciating just how photovoltaic panels can harness the sun's power to power homes, organizations, and also satellites in space.

Exactly How Solar Panels Generate Electrical Power



Photovoltaic panel harness the sun's energy by converting sunlight into electrical energy through a process referred to as the photovoltaic or pv result. When sunlight strikes the solar panels, the photons (light fragments) are soaked up by the semiconducting products within the panels, generally made of silicon. This absorption creates an electrical current as the photons knock electrons loosened from the atoms within the material.

Comprehending Solar Panel Parts



One crucial facet of photovoltaic panel technology is recognizing the different elements that make up a solar panel system.

In addition to the panels, there are inverters that transform the direct existing (DC) electrical energy generated by the panels into alternating current (AC) power that can be made use of in homes or services.

The system also consists of racking to sustain and position the photovoltaic panels for ideal sunlight exposure. Furthermore, wires and ports are necessary for moving the power produced by the panels to the electric system of a building.

Last but not least, a surveillance system might be consisted of to track the performance of the solar panel system and guarantee it's functioning efficiently. Understanding these components is crucial for anybody looking to install or make use of photovoltaic panel modern technology properly.
